Output 312493eaa92eb58f33deda5501f98c94a9c40782282af9fe8f0f9976e6a4cc29:1

value
4688666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e495d92a86af93ec90029053bc99a2dacd65e1 OP_EQUAL
address
34gwP53X4LD7MuSv7DMoc96W8nkywuK7Gm
transaction
312493eaa92eb58f33deda5501f98c94a9c40782282af9fe8f0f9976e6a4cc29
spent
true